Newp: 1859 Seat Dollar Proof

PedzolaPedzola Posts: 1,028 ✭✭✭✭✭

I guess I am officially exploring numismatic horizons beyond my gold type set.

My local dealer had this very special coin which I couldnt turn away from.

1859 $1 PR63 CAC

Being a proof coin I had to take a shot at photography. First here is trueview.

And here is my best attempt with axial lighting. I think this shows the surfaces and in-hand look a little better than the TV.

However, change the lighting and you see something else. The coin looks cameo in hand with strong contrast. I'm a little surprised it didnt get the designation.

Here is a quick shot with direct lighting. It is maybe the most realistic first impression in hand. A little tilt in the light and you see the bright colors around the rim but the mirror and cameo is the first thing that jumps out at me. It's fun to twirl this one around.

I guess I will start working on a silver dollar type set. Or an 1859 proof set?

    yosclimberyosclimber Posts: 5,290 ✭✭✭✭✭

    Beautiful coins.

    FYI, your 1859 proof half dime is the V-1 with RPD on all digits, most visibly on the 1.
    It is also the one year hub type with "hollow stars" by Paquet that was only used in Philadelphia.
